Thread Material Consistency
Because KO thread is 100 % pre‑waxed nylon, its material consistency stays uniform from spool to spool, giving you reliable colorfastness and minimal fraying even when you pull tight knots. You’ll notice the 0.008‑inch (0.2032 mm) diameter matches size B needles, so tension feels the same across projects. The pre‑wax coating reduces tangles, letting you form secure knots without the thread slipping or fraying. Color stays true because each of the 18 shades is dyed on the same nylon base, so a black spool matches a black bead exactly, even after multiple washes. This durability lets you work on seed‑bead, loom, peyote, or brick‑stitch designs without worrying about the thread weakening or changing texture mid‑project.

Thread Diameter Compatibility
The wax‑coated surface you just read about also dictates how well a KO thread fits through the tiniest bead holes, so matching its diameter to your needle and bead size is key. A fine‑beadweaver typically chooses a thread that mirrors Nymo size B, roughly 0.008 inches (0.2032 mm). At that thickness the 330 TEX nylon KO slides easily through seed and Delica beads without fraying. You’ll want a thread that pairs well with size 10 or size 12 beading needles—these gauges accommodate the 0.008‑inch diameter while still allowing tight knots. Because KO threads keep the same diameter across colors, you can swap white, gold, or other shades without adjusting needle size or bead selection. This uniformity ensures consistent tension and smooth knotting throughout your project.
